AEW Files To Trademark ‘Varsity Club’

A new varsity trademark for AEW. 

On October 10, AEW applied to trademark “Varsity Club” for entertainment services.

On the October 7 episode of AEW Dynamite, Mark Sterling announced that he had a copyright on “Varsity” and would prevent the Varsity Blonds (Griff Garrison & Brian Pillman Jr) from using the name. AEW applied to trademark “Varsity Athletes” on the same day.

Varsity Club was a stable in the late 1980s in NWA featuring Kevin Sullivan, Mike Rotunda, Rick Steiner, Steve Williams, Dan Spivey, and Leia Meow. Sullivan, Rotunda, and Steiner reunited the group in 1999.

Full description: 

Mark For: VARSITY CLUB trademark registration is intended to cover the categories of entertainment in the nature of live performances by a group or individual wrestlers; Entertainment services, namely, live appearances by a group or individual wrestlers; Entertainment services, namely, televised appearances by a group or individual wrestlers; Entertainment services, namely, wrestling exhibits and performances by a professional wrestler and entertainer.
